Mr. Munkel seconded the motion, <br />which carried unanimously. <br /> <br />AGENDA #2 - LIQUOR LICENSE - 6714 OLIVE BLVD.: <br /> <br />The new owner of Molly O'Ryan's has applied for a license to sell all types of <br />intoxicating beverages by the drink for consumption on the premises in conjunction with <br />the food service. It appears that all ordinance requirements are met. There have not <br />been an unusual number of police calls at these premises in recent years. The <br />applicant appears to have a clear record for the past ten years. The City Council may <br />therefore approve this application. <br /> <br />Mr. Munkel moved approval. Ms. Colquitt seconded the motion. <br /> <br />Responding to Mr. Lieberman, Mr. Ollendorff said that this was strictly a transfer. Mr. <br />Ollendorff said that he would check, but he does not believe that there has been any <br />lapse in this license, but he will check on it tomorrow and let Mr. Lieberman know if he is <br />wrong. <br /> <br />The motion to approve carried unanimously. <br /> <br />AGENDA #3 - LIQUOR LICENSE - 8224 OLIVE BLVD.: <br /> <br /> <br />
